Indeed: The Go-To Aggregator
Indeed is arguably the most comprehensive job search engine on the internet. Think of it as the Google of job boards. It aggregates listings from company career pages, other job boards, and staffing agencies, giving you a massive pool of opportunities to explore. Its simple interface allows you to search by keyword, location, and salary, making it easy to narrow down your options. One of the key features of Indeed is its ability to save your resume and apply directly to many jobs through the platform, streamlining the application process. The sheer volume of listings on Indeed can be overwhelming, but its advanced search filters and job alerts help you stay on top of relevant opportunities. For example, you can set up alerts to receive daily or weekly emails with new job postings that match your criteria. This ensures you never miss a potentially perfect job. Moreover, Indeed provides company reviews and salary information, giving you valuable insights into potential employers. This information can be crucial in making informed decisions about where to apply and what to expect in terms of compensation and company culture. LinkedIn: Networking and Job Searching Combined
LinkedIn is more than just a job board; it's a professional networking platform where you can connect with colleagues, industry leaders, and potential employers. While it's a great place to build your professional brand and network, LinkedIn also boasts a robust job search function. Its advantage lies in its ability to leverage your network and provide insights into companies and hiring managers. You can see who in your network works at a particular company or is connected to the hiring manager, giving you a potential leg up in the application process. LinkedIn allows you to search for jobs based on title, skills, location, and industry. You can also set up job alerts and receive notifications when new positions matching your criteria are posted. One of the most valuable features of LinkedIn is its "Easy Apply" option, which allows you to apply for jobs directly through the platform using your LinkedIn profile. This significantly simplifies the application process and saves you time. Furthermore, LinkedIn provides a wealth of company information, including employee reviews, salary data, and company updates, helping you make informed decisions about your career. LinkedIn is also an excellent resource for researching industries and job roles. You can explore different career paths, learn about required skills and qualifications, and connect with professionals in your field. This makes it an invaluable tool for career exploration and planning. Glassdoor: Transparency and Insights
Glassdoor stands out for its commitment to transparency, offering a wealth of information about companies, including employee reviews, salary data, and interview experiences. This makes it an invaluable resource for job seekers who want to get an inside look at potential employers. One of Glassdoor's key features is its company review section, where current and former employees share their experiences working at the company. These reviews can provide valuable insights into the company's culture, management style, and work-life balance. This information can help you determine if a company is a good fit for you. Glassdoor also offers a salary comparison tool, which allows you to research the average salaries for different positions at various companies. This is crucial for negotiating your salary and ensuring you're being fairly compensated. The platform also features a database of interview questions and experiences, giving you a glimpse into the hiring process at different companies. This can help you prepare for interviews and increase your chances of success. In addition to its company information, Glassdoor also has a job board where you can search for open positions. You can filter your search by location, job title, and industry. Glassdoor's job board is particularly useful for those who want to work at a specific company, as you can easily find all the open positions at that company. AngelList: Startups and Tech
If you're passionate about startups and the tech industry, AngelList is the place to be. This platform focuses exclusively on connecting job seekers with startups, from early-stage ventures to established companies. AngelList offers a unique opportunity to work in a fast-paced, innovative environment and be part of a company's growth story. One of the key features of AngelList is its focus on transparency. Companies often share detailed information about their mission, values, and culture, giving you a clear picture of what it's like to work there. You can also see the company's funding history and team members, which can help you assess its potential for success. AngelList's job board is specifically tailored to the startup world, with listings for a wide range of roles, including engineering, product, marketing, and sales. You can filter your search by location, salary, and equity, making it easy to find opportunities that align with your goals. The platform also offers a built-in messaging system, allowing you to connect directly with founders and hiring managers. Tailor Your Resume and Cover Letter
Generic resumes and cover letters are a surefire way to get lost in the shuffle. Always tailor your resume and cover letter to the specific job you're applying for. Highlight the skills and experiences that are most relevant to the position and demonstrate how you can contribute to the company. Read the job description carefully and identify the key requirements and qualifications. Then, customize your resume and cover letter to address those points directly. Use keywords from the job description to ensure your application gets noticed by applicant tracking systems (ATS). A well-tailored resume and cover letter show that you've taken the time to understand the job and the company, and that you're genuinely interested in the opportunity.
